No, 1 horsepower (hp) is not equal to 1 kilowatt (kW). 1 horsepower is approximately equal to 0.7355 kilowatts. How do you convert hp to kW? To convert horsepower (hp) to kilowatts (kW), you can use the following conversion formula: kW = hp Γ— 0.7355 Let’s say you have an electric motor rated at 200 kilowatts (kW) at peak power output. Haw many horsepowers in a kilowatt? 1 kilowatt is equal to 1.34102209 horsepowers, which is the conversion factor from kilowatts to horsepowers. To figure out how many kilowatt-hours (kWh) your solar panel system puts out per year, you need to multiply the size of your system in kW DC times the .8 derate factor times the number of hours of sun. So if you have a 7.5 kW DC system working an average of 5 hours per day, 365 days a year, it’ll result in 10,950 kWh in a year. PYSB.
